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a simple temporary column suitable as a ladder for a work site and a column of a temporary working platform, and superior in easiness-to-use, without hindering installation work of a support and a PC beam supported by a side surface of the column or effective use and work of a slab surface . <P>SOLUTION: This temporary column 1 has a fixing part 6 fixable to an exposed reinforcement 5 in the vicinity of a corner part 4 of the column 3 in an upper part of a shaft body 2; has two or more places of corner part engaging parts 7 and 8 engageable with the corner part 4 of the column 3 in a proper position of the shaft body 2; prevents run-out in the horizontal direction of the shaft body 2 by engagement with the corner part 4 of the column 3 of these corner part engaging parts 7 and 8; and is constituted to be detachably suspended by fixing the fixing part 6 to the exposed reinforcement 5 in the vicinity of the corner part 4 of the column 3.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2005,JPO&NCIPI

When a precast concrete beam (PC beam) is installed on the upper part of the pillar under construction, the worker goes up into a narrow space outside the exposed reinforcing bar exposed at the upper part of the pillar and gives instructions to the operator of the heavy machinery. However, work forms such as performing work have been widely performed. However, this work form has a problem that not only the workability is not good but also the danger is not small. Therefore, a ladder with a work table that is prevented from falling by leaning on the side surface of the pillar and hooking the upper part to the exposed reinforcing bar is also disclosed (see Patent Document 1). However, since this ladder with a work table is used by leaning on the side surface of the column, there is a problem that a problem arises when competing with the side surface on which the support or PC beam is supported by the side surface of the column. In addition, since it is installed on the slab surface, there is a problem that the slab surface is effectively used and the work is hindered. On the other hand, a working scaffold configured so as to be able to be hung using an exposed reinforcing bar of a column under construction is also conventionally known (see Patent Document 2). However, in this conventional work scaffold, a support form in which the scaffold is suspended from the flat portion of the side surface of the column has been adopted. Therefore, in order to prevent lateral runout, the lateral width is increased to some extent, and a plurality of scaffolds are suspended. It was necessary to adopt a large-scale structure that was supported by the exposed steel bars of the book. For this reason, there is a problem that the weight is increased and a large work load is applied to transportation and suspension work. In addition, since it is installed on the side surface of the column, there is a similar problem that a problem arises when competing with the side supported by the side of the column or the side where the PC beam is installed. Furthermore, it was technically difficult to add a function as a ladder.
JP 2001-182465 A JP 7-180345 A

According to the present invention, the following effects can be obtained.
(1) Utilizing the corners of the pillars under construction, the corners engaging portions provided on the shafts constituting the temporary support columns are engaged to prevent the shafts from shaking in the lateral direction. Therefore, it is possible to accurately prevent lateral shake by a simple configuration.
(2) Since it is possible to prevent lateral swing of the temporary support column by a simple configuration in which a corner engaging portion is provided on the shaft body, it is a light-weight, easy-to-use and easy-to-use simple temporary installation A support post can be provided.
(3) Since the temporary support columns are suspended along the corners of the pillars, the support work supported by the side surfaces of the pillars and the installation work such as PC beams are not hindered.
(4) Since the support structure that is hooked to the exposed reinforcing bars near the corners of the pillars via the hooks provided on the upper part of the shaft body constituting the temporary support column is adopted, Combined with the lateral shake prevention function, the temporary support column can be suspended along the corner of the column simply and detachably.
(5) Since the temporary support columns are hung on the exposed reinforcing bars, there is no hindrance to effective use or work of the slab surface.
